Pregunta

Estoy buscando dar la posibilidad al usuario de modificar código en una parte mínima de una aplicación de rieles, parte que se encuentra en el directorio de la aplicación. Estoy atascado con el "no recargar nada automáticamente en producción", ¿hay alguna manera de evitarlo?

(hablando de " personalización de plantilla de usuario " ;; ¿es líquido una forma de superar este problema? No lo parece, pero aún así podría serlo).

gracias si hay alguna ayuda.

¿Fue útil?

Solución

¿Permitir que un usuario modifique el código? WTF !?

En otras palabras, recomendaría contra eso. :)

Otros consejos

Puede implementar su aplicación en modo de desarrollo ...

Pero, de nuevo, como dijo fig-gnuton, no debes hacer eso, debe haber una mejor manera de hacer lo que estás tratando de hacer.

¿Seguramente para eso sirven las variables y la base de datos? Almacenar las preferencias del usuario y usar esas preferencias para alterar lo que se genera en el navegador del usuario.

¿Por personalización de plantilla te refieres a los archivos .html.erb? ¿Por qué no puedes usar CSS para hacer esto usando algún tipo de locura de clase corporal?

Le sugiero que no permita que los usuarios cambien el contenido de la aplicación. En cambio, si desea que los usuarios cambien las plantillas, debe almacenarlas en la base de datos. Al igual que los browsercms y los proyectos Radiant, por mencionar algunos, sí.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top